Get started91b is a one-bedroom semi-detached house in High Wycombe (HP13 5AA). It has a recorded floor area of 50 m² (around 538 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(July 2016) shows a D (score 65),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 3 certificates since June 2009.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Poor to Good, window efficiency went from Poor to Average and lighting went from Very Poor to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 75). At 50 m² this is the 3rd smallest of 21 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 40–234 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to B across 21 units on file.
It hasn't traded since June 2010, a hold of 16 years that's notably long for the area.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 7.9%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£195,000 sits 63.9% above the 2010 sale of £119,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£221/sq ft) was about 22% below the postcode norm. At 50 m² it sits well below the postcode median (133 m² across 20 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ally.
